Watts Law Printable Practice Watt s Law Combining the elements of voltage current and power named after James Watt Watt s Law is defined as the following formula latex text P text E text I latex Where P Power in watts E Voltage in volts I Current in amps Electric power is the rate at which energy is transferred It s measured in terms of
Watts Law Formula Examples and Applications June 15 2022 by Electricalvoice Watt s law describes the relationship among electric current voltage and electrical power According to this law the power in a circuit is a product of the voltage and the electric current This section provides a brief description of two of the most fundamental electrical relationships Ohm s law which describes current flow in electrical circuits and Watt s law which describes how power is dissipated

1 Write the 3 symbols used in Watt s Law 2 Enter the information given in the problem 3 Cover the symbol for the unknown value 4 Write the formula you are going to use 5 Put the given values in place of the symbols 6 Solve the problem Example If the voltage to a light bulb is 120 volts and the wattage is 60 watts what is the

Ohm s Law Combining the elements of voltage current and resistance Ohm developed the formula Where V Voltage in volts I Current in amps R Resistance in ohms This is called Ohm s law Let s say for example that we have a circuit with the potential of 1 volt a current of 1 amp and resistance of 1 ohm Using Ohm s Law we can say

According to Watt s Law Power Volts multiplied by Current P V I Power Current squared times Resistance P I2 R Real world example Suppose you wanted to figure out how many 500 watt lighting instruments you could plug into a circuit without blowing a fuse

Watts Law Examples Here are some examples of Watts law solved The one hundred watt light bulb is attached to 120 volts power supply Through the use of Watts Law we can find the current flowing through the light bulb P I V 100 I 120 I 0 83 A The current flowing in the bulb will be 0 83 A
